Take university pre-approved courses, specializations, and certificates and earn credit* toward applicable degree … Web15 nov. 2024 · A master’s degree is typically a year or two long. They will normally require 180 credits to complete. A postgraduate diploma takes nine to 12 months to complete. They normally require 120 credits to complete, however, they are much cheaper to do. A postgraduate certificate typically lasts a term or two (15-30 weeks). flipped shape
